The Best Swiss Cheese And Beer Fondue

Ingredients

  • Servings: 6
  • 8 ounces emmentaler cheese, shredded
  • 8 ounces gruyere cheese, shredded
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t, or to taste
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ground pepper, or to taste
  • 16 fluid ounces beer
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ons dijon mustard
  • 1 baguette, sliced or torn into chunky 1-inch pieces

Recipe

    Preparation Time: 10 mins Cook Time: 15 mins Ready Time: 25 mins

  • toss emmentaler cheese, gruyere cheese, cornstarch, salt, and pepper together in a large bowl.
  • pour beer into a heavy pot over medium-low heat; bring to a simmer until gently warmed, about 5 minutes.
  • stir cheese mixture into simmering beer in small amounts, assuring each addition melts fully into the mixture and that the mixture has returned to a simmer before adding the next batch, 10 to 15 minutes total.
  • stir mustard into the cheese mixture and remove pot from heat. taste fondue and adjust seasonings to taste. pour fondue into a fondue dish. serve with the baguette.
